    Brief

    This funding opportunity supports the employment and operational costs of resettlement workers for the 12-month period from April 2026 through March 2027. Eligible applicants can seek financial support to hire, train, and deploy resettlement workers who assist individuals and families in transitioning to new communities. Funding may cover worker salaries, benefits, training materials, and related administrative expenses. Organizations providing resettlement services, including housing assistance, integration support, and community orientation, are encouraged to apply. This is a time-limited funding cycle with a specific contract period ending March 2027.
